Transaction 70df33b76eebb23e025787c41604b293e02bf71400197250858fd3df9f3dc892
1 Input
2 Outputs
- 70df33b76eebb23e025787c41604b293e02bf71400197250858fd3df9f3dc892:0
- 70df33b76eebb23e025787c41604b293e02bf71400197250858fd3df9f3dc892:1
value 1200000
address 1J6Ebk9XUZYMi8QC26o14sPzVMPmJHoL4C
value 309290000
address 16MUDCRZ3fXAsSp6UrArj6V4LD7dkhbzoR